Light the Air San Jose, California
Light the Air is the solo side project of The Analog Affair co-producer Evan Baker. A recent transplant to San Jose by way of Wyoming, China, and Washington D.C., Light the Air is an eclectic sounding board of everything from acoustic singer-songwriter "Pajama Jams" to indie pop and alternative electronica. ... more
